MONACO: Monaco says top scorer Radamel Falcao will be out for up to three weeks after sustaining a left thigh muscle injury during a 3-2 home win against Lyon.

The Colombia striker limped off early in the second half of Sunday's game, having earlier scored his 17th league goal of the season and 23rd overall.

Defending champion Monaco, which is in third place and one point behind Marseille, travels to play Angers on Saturday.

In Falcao's absence, and with fellow striker Keita Balde suspended for his sending off against Lyon, Stevan Jovetic is likely to play in attack.

Jovetic set up Rony Lopes' late winner against Lyon, after replacing Falcao.
